What is the Life Cycle of Software Development (SDLC)? Software development life cycle (SDLC) is a structured frame that outlines the steps involved in the development of software and ensures that it meets business objectives, technical standards and needs of users. SDLC provides: A roadmap step by step for software development. Quality Ensuring through systematic testing and verification. Cost and time efficiency by minimizing risk and optimizing workflows.
